Location of the Paddlewheel Flow Sensor Package
The flow sensor is to be mounted on the outlet piping of each softener for single and duplex and triplex parallel systems
and in the common outlet piping of duplex alternating systems.
The piping that the flow sensor is being connected to should be the same diameter as the mounting fitting. The flow sen-
sor must also be located in a free-flowing straight run of pipe. This straight run includes the upstream piping and down-
stream piping of the flow sensor.
The proper length of upstream and downstream straight piping is a minimum of 10 pipe diameters of free-flowing straight
pipe upstream of the flow sensor and 5 pipe diameters of free-flowing straight pipe downstream.
EXAMPLE: A flow sensor that is installed on a length of 2” diameter straight pipe (see Figure 17).
Major obstructions will require considerably longer straight runs of upstream piping, due to the turbulence created by their
presence.
EXAMPLE: A flow sensor on a length of 2” diameter pipe that has a 90° elbow upstream from the desired location (see
Figure 18).
The examples below are intended as guide lines for the proper length of straight pipe required both upstream and down-
stream of the flow sensor installation point.
These recommendations are minimum requirements (see Figure 16).
